EL ELYON

A Hebrew designation meaning the most high God, as in Gen. 14: 18-20, 22. It is the name for deity worshipped by Melchizedek, king of Salem, and appears for the first time in the Bible in Gen. 14: 18. It is found also in Acts 16: 17. Cf. D&C 59: 10-12; D&C 76: 12.
